The Chicago Bears selected wide receiver Rome Odunze with the ninth overall pick in the 2024 NFL draft, just eight selections after they chose quarterback Caleb Williams with the first pick.
Odunze (illness) doesn't have an injury designation for Sunday's game against the Packers. Odunze returned to full practice participation Friday after an illness kept him out the previous two days.
